-/**
- * This class is used to validate an {@link VerifyXMLSignatureResponse}
- * returned by MOA-SPSS
- *
- * @author Stefan Knirsch
- * @version $Id$
- */
-public class VerifyXMLSignatureResponseValidator {
-
- /** Identification string for checking identity link */
- public static final String CHECK_IDENTITY_LINK = "IdentityLink";
- /** Identification string for checking authentication block */
- public static final String CHECK_AUTH_BLOCK = "AuthBlock";
-
- /** Singleton instance. <code>null</code>, if none has been created. */
- private static VerifyXMLSignatureResponseValidator instance;
-
- /**
- * Constructor for a singleton VerifyXMLSignatureResponseValidator.
- */
- public static synchronized VerifyXMLSignatureResponseValidator getInstance()
- throws ValidateException {
- if (instance == null) {
- instance = new VerifyXMLSignatureResponseValidator();
- }
- return instance;
- }
-
- /**
- * Validates a {@link VerifyXMLSignatureResponse} returned by MOA-SPSS.
- *
- * @param verifyXMLSignatureResponse the <code>&lt;VerifyXMLSignatureResponse&gt;</code>
- * @param identityLinkSignersSubjectDNNames subject names configured
- * @param whatToCheck is used to identify whether the identityLink or the Auth-Block is validated
- * @param oaParam specifies whether the validation result of the
- * manifest has to be ignored (identityLink validation if
- * the OA is a business service) or not
- * @throws ValidateException on any validation error
- * @throws ConfigurationException
- */
- public void validate(IVerifiyXMLSignatureResponse verifyXMLSignatureResponse,
- List<String> identityLinkSignersSubjectDNNames,
- String whatToCheck,
- IOAAuthParameters oaParam)
- throws ValidateException, ConfigurationException {
-
- if (verifyXMLSignatureResponse.getSignatureCheckCode() != 0)
- throw new ValidateException("validator.06", null);
-
- if (verifyXMLSignatureResponse.getCertificateCheckCode() != 0) {
- String checkFailedReason ="";
- if (verifyXMLSignatureResponse.getCertificateCheckCode() == 1)
- checkFailedReason = MOAIDMessageProvider.getInstance().getMessage("validator.21", null);
- if (verifyXMLSignatureResponse.getCertificateCheckCode() == 2)
- checkFailedReason = MOAIDMessageProvider.getInstance().getMessage("validator.22", null);
- if (verifyXMLSignatureResponse.getCertificateCheckCode() == 3)
- checkFailedReason = MOAIDMessageProvider.getInstance().getMessage("validator.23", null);
- if (verifyXMLSignatureResponse.getCertificateCheckCode() == 4)
- checkFailedReason = MOAIDMessageProvider.getInstance().getMessage("validator.24", null);
- if (verifyXMLSignatureResponse.getCertificateCheckCode() == 5)
- checkFailedReason = MOAIDMessageProvider.getInstance().getMessage("validator.25", null);
-
-// TEST CARDS
- if (whatToCheck.equals(CHECK_IDENTITY_LINK))
- throw new ValidateException("validator.07", new Object[] { checkFailedReason } );
- else
- throw new ValidateException("validator.19", new Object[] { checkFailedReason } );
- }
-
- //check QC
- if (AuthConfigurationProviderFactory.getInstance().isCertifiacteQCActive() &&
- !whatToCheck.equals(CHECK_IDENTITY_LINK) &&
- !verifyXMLSignatureResponse.isQualifiedCertificate()) {
-
- //check if testcards are active and certificate has an extension for test credentials
- if (oaParam.isTestCredentialEnabled()) {
- boolean foundTestCredentialOID = false;
- try {
- X509Certificate signerCert = verifyXMLSignatureResponse.getX509certificate();
-
- List<String> validOIDs = new ArrayList<String>();
- if (oaParam.getTestCredentialOIDs() != null)
- validOIDs.addAll(oaParam.getTestCredentialOIDs());
- else
- validOIDs.add(MOAIDAuthConstants.TESTCREDENTIALROOTOID);
-
- Set<String> extentsions = signerCert.getCriticalExtensionOIDs();
- extentsions.addAll(signerCert.getNonCriticalExtensionOIDs());
- Iterator<String> extit = extentsions.iterator();
- while(extit.hasNext()) {
- String certOID = extit.next();
- for (String el : validOIDs) {
- if (certOID.startsWith(el))
- foundTestCredentialOID = true;
- }
- }
-
- } catch (Exception e) {
- Logger.warn("Test credential OID extraction FAILED.", e);
-
- }
- //throw Exception if not TestCredentialOID is found
- if (!foundTestCredentialOID)
- throw new ValidateException("validator.72", null);
-
- } else
- throw new ValidateException("validator.71", null);
- }
-
- // if OA is type is business service the manifest validation result has
- // to be ignored
- boolean ignoreManifestValidationResult = false;
- if (whatToCheck.equals(CHECK_IDENTITY_LINK))
- ignoreManifestValidationResult = (oaParam.hasBaseIdInternalProcessingRestriction()) ? true
- : false;
-
- if (ignoreManifestValidationResult) {
- Logger.debug("OA type is business service, thus ignoring DSIG manifest validation result");
- } else {
- if (verifyXMLSignatureResponse.isXmlDSIGManigest())
- if (verifyXMLSignatureResponse.getXmlDSIGManifestCheckCode() != 0)
- throw new ValidateException("validator.08", null);
- }
-
-
- // Check the signature manifest only when verifying the signed AUTHBlock
- if (whatToCheck.equals(CHECK_AUTH_BLOCK)) {
- if (verifyXMLSignatureResponse.getSignatureManifestCheckCode() > 0) {
- throw new ValidateException("validator.50", null);
- }
- }
-
- //Check whether the returned X509 SubjectName is in the MOA-ID configuration or not
- if (identityLinkSignersSubjectDNNames != null) {
- String subjectDN = "";
- X509Certificate x509Cert = verifyXMLSignatureResponse.getX509certificate();
- try {
- subjectDN = ((Name) x509Cert.getSubjectDN()).getRFC2253String();
- }
- catch (RFC2253NameParserException e) {
- throw new ValidateException("validator.17", null);
- }
- //System.out.println("subjectDN: " + subjectDN);
- // check the authorisation to sign the identity link
- if (!identityLinkSignersSubjectDNNames.contains(subjectDN)) {
- // subject DN check failed, try OID check:
- try {
- if (x509Cert.getExtension(MOAIDAuthConstants.IDENTITY_LINK_SIGNER_OID) == null) {
- throw new ValidateException("validator.18", new Object[] { subjectDN });
- } else {
- Logger.debug("Identity link signer cert accepted for signing identity link: " +
- "subjectDN check failed, but OID check successfully passed.");
- }
- } catch (X509ExtensionInitException e) {
- throw new ValidateException("validator.49", null);
- }
- } else {
- Logger.debug("Identity link signer cert accepted for signing identity link: " +
- "subjectDN check successfully passed.");
- }
-
- }
- }

- /**
- * Method validateCertificate.
- * @param verifyXMLSignatureResponse The VerifyXMLSignatureResponse
- * @param idl The Identitylink
- * @throws ValidateException
- */
- public void validateCertificate(
- IVerifiyXMLSignatureResponse verifyXMLSignatureResponse,
- IIdentityLink idl)
- throws ValidateException {
-
- X509Certificate x509Response = verifyXMLSignatureResponse.getX509certificate();
- PublicKey[] pubKeysIdentityLink = (PublicKey[]) idl.getPublicKey();
-
- PublicKey pubKeySignature = x509Response.getPublicKey();
-
- boolean found = false;
- for (int i = 0; i < pubKeysIdentityLink.length; i++) {
-
- //compare RSAPublicKeys
- if ((idl.getPublicKey()[i] instanceof java.security.interfaces.RSAPublicKey) &&
- (pubKeySignature instanceof java.security.interfaces.RSAPublicKey)) {
-
- RSAPublicKey rsaPubKeySignature = (RSAPublicKey) pubKeySignature;
- RSAPublicKey rsakey = (RSAPublicKey) pubKeysIdentityLink[i];
-
- if (rsakey.getModulus().equals(rsaPubKeySignature.getModulus())
- && rsakey.getPublicExponent().equals(rsaPubKeySignature.getPublicExponent()))
- found = true;
- }
-
- //compare ECDSAPublicKeys
- if( ( (idl.getPublicKey()[i] instanceof java.security.interfaces.ECPublicKey) ||
- (idl.getPublicKey()[i] instanceof ECPublicKey)) &&
- ( (pubKeySignature instanceof java.security.interfaces.ECPublicKey) ||
- (pubKeySignature instanceof ECPublicKey) ) ) {
-
- try {
- ECPublicKey ecdsaPubKeySignature = new ECPublicKey(pubKeySignature.getEncoded());
- ECPublicKey ecdsakey = new ECPublicKey(pubKeysIdentityLink[i].getEncoded());
-
- if(ecdsakey.equals(ecdsaPubKeySignature))
- found = true;
-
- } catch (InvalidKeyException e) {
- Logger.warn("ECPublicKey can not parsed into a iaik.ECPublicKey", e);
- throw new ValidateException("validator.09", null);
- }
-
-
-
- }
-
-// Logger.debug("IDL-Pubkey=" + idl.getPublicKey()[i].getClass().getName()
-// + " Resp-Pubkey=" + pubKeySignature.getClass().getName());
-
- }
-
- if (!found) {
-
- throw new ValidateException("validator.09", null);
-
- }
- }
-
-}
